| With the development of football,the changeable formation and the fast pace of attack and defense,the requirements for players on the field have become more stringent.In the competition,players should give full play to the individual’s technical and tactical ability.At the same time,they should also have sufficient physical fitness and reaction speed.Agility is a comprehensive reflection of a variety of physical qualities,which puts forward higher requirements for the agility quality.The training period for football specialized students is generally short,and they did not receive systematic football training in their adolescence.However,the university football courses focus more on football technical training while less on physical training,and neglect agility training.Aim: This study used the agility quality as an entry point to develop an experimental intervention for plyometrics training for football specialized students of Shenyang Sport University.Selected multiple test indicators that reflect the agility quality of football sports were used to verify experimentally that plyometrics training has a positive effect on the agility qualities of football specialized students;.Through the analysis of the test indicators,the reasons for the effects on the agility quality of football specialized students had been explored.Methods: Literature data,expert interview,mathematical statistics methods and experimental methods were used in the study.The experimental intervention was conducted on 16 players of football specialized students of Shenyang Sport University,and a plyometrics training program was applied in the experimental group,while a resistance strength training program was applied in the control group.In this study,a total of 8 test indicators including standing long jump,4x10 m reentrant run,"T" shape run test,Rollator type test,AFL test(no ball,balled),Illinois test,Nelson’s Choice Response test were selected,and the statistical analysis of experimental test data was performed between and within groups using SPSS Statistics 20 Software.Result: After the 8-week plyometrics training intervention,all 8 test indicators in the experimental group showed significant changes.However,the control group showed significant changes only in four of the test indicators.Between groups,a significant difference was observed between the experimental and control groups in three of eight test indicators.Conclusion:1.The plyometrics training could effectively improve lower limbs’ explosive force.Both groups had obvious effects on improving the explosive force of the lower limbs in standing long junmp,but the increase in the control group was lower than that in the experimental group,indicating that plyometrics training,compared with conventional resistance training,can better improve the lower limbs’ explosive force of football specialized students,thereby improving agility qualities better.2.The plyometrics training was effective in improving the agility qualities of football specialized students in ball free situations..Students in the experimental group all improved to various degrees on the six ball free agility tests,which yielded a significant difference.And the test scores of the control group were compared between groups,and significant differences were found in three of them,which indicated that the lift efficiency was higher than that of the control group.3.The plyometrics training significantly improved the AFL ball test performances of football specialized students,indicating that the improvement of agility qualities is helpful for students’ ability to combine balls,and plyometrics training can achieve the goal of improving the technical level of football by enhancing students’ agility.4.A total of 16 students in both groups achieved gains in all the agility tests after the experiment,indicating that agility qualities were more influenced by the lower limb muscle strength and explosive force.Both training methods have achieved their goal of enhancing agility by improving muscle strength,and plyometrics training is a more effective training method. |
